The role also includes system ownership, mentoring engineers, and working with modern cloud and infrastructure technologies. 🗂️ Requirements: 6+ years of Java development experience, Experience with Agile methodologies, Experience with Azure, AWS, or other cloud platforms, Experience with Terraform, Experience in system design, Experience leading projects from technical perspective, Good English communication skills, Proactive attitude 📃 Skills: Java, Spring, Azure, Terraform, Kubernetes, PostgreSQL, CI/CD, AWS, Scrum, Kanban, Microservices 🏢 Description: About the role The Audience Platform team is part of Customers API, the platform that holds core data about Tesco customers and powers personalized customer communication and experiences across Tesco. The platform processes around 500 million customer attribute updates every week and continues to grow as Tesco increases the scale, relevance, and personalization of customer engagement. Built as a cloud-native microservice architecture on Azure, the platform uses Azure Service Bus for event-driven processing, PostgreSQL for data storage, and is currently evolving from Azure App Services towards Kubernetes to support the next stage of scalability and resilience. As a Senior Software Engineer in this team will be responsible for designing, building, and maintaining highly scalable services that process large volumes of customer data while keeping the platform reliable, performant, and maintainable. The role will focus on solving real-world scalability and performance challenges in a modern service with low technical debt, while contributing to the team’s migration to Kubernetes and continued evolution of its architecture. Looking ahead, the team will also explore how to leverage the data in the platform using LLMs, embeddings, new database technologies, and UI capabilities to reduce the time needed to create new customer audiences. This is an opportunity for a senior engineer to work on a business-critical platform that directly enables personalized experiences for Tesco customers at massive scale. The engineer will design scalable architectures that handle millions of product events weekly. 🗂️ Requirements: Strong experience with Java, Strong experience with Spring Boot, Basic knowledge of Python, Experience with Apache Kafka, Understanding of event-driven architecture, Experience with Azure cloud platform, Experience with Kubernetes, Knowledge of PostgreSQL, Knowledge of NoSQL databases, Experience with RESTful APIs, Experience with microservices architecture, Understanding of CI/CD practices, Experience with distributed systems 📃 Skills: Java, SpringBoot, Python, Kafka, Azure, Kubernetes, PostgreSQL, NoSQL, REST, Microservices, CI/CD, PGVector, Terraform, LLM 🏢 Description: About the role The Product Intelligence Platform is an AI-driven system that revolutionizes how Tesco handles product data at scale. The platform leverages multi-agent AI systems to automate product categorization, enrichment, and matching across a vast number of products on a weekly basis. Built on event-driven architecture using Kafka, the platform processes millions of events monthly through core AI capabilities. A Senior Software Engineer in this team will be responsible for building and maintaining these AI-powered capabilities using Java/Spring Boot and Python, implementing scalable event-driven microservices on Azure Kubernetes Service, and working directly with LLMs to solve complex product intelligence challenges. The role requires someone who can bridge the gap between cutting-edge AI technology, engineering, and practical business applications, contributing to a platform that directly impacts millions of customer interactions weekly. At HERE Technologies, we work with diverse and complex datasets, including: Automotive-grade digital maps with detailed road topology and thousands of attributes. Large-scale geospatial, dynamic, interactive datasets that change rapidly. Fast-changing data streams like traffic, weather, and sensor feeds. The challenge is to efficiently store, index, analyze, and connect these datasets while ensuring they are easily and reliably available to our users. At the same time, we need to scale and adapt quickly to meet growing demands. The Solution Out company enables customers to build, deploy, and manage location-based applications on our cloud infrastructure. With powerful abstractions, state-of-the-art building blocks, and cutting-edge cloud technologies, our map making platform allows customers to ingest, store, share, and analyze location data in real-time. Data can be combined, enriched, and shared among platform members, unlocking even greater potential.
